The Independent National Electoral Commission, INEC, has warned Labour Party, LP, and its presidential candidate, Peter Obi to stop blaming the commission for their inability to effectively prosecute their case at the Presidential Election Petition Tribunal, PEPT.

INEC’s lawyer, Kemi Pinheiro issued this warning while reacting to a claim by the lawyer to LP and Obi, Livy Uzoukwu on Wednesday.

Uzoukwu claimed that the office of the Chairman of INEC declined to accept a subpoena served on Prof. Mahmood Yakubu to produce some documents.

INEC lawyer,warned Labour Party not to use them as a whipping boy. He said that the office of INEC Chairman did not refuse to accept a subpoena.
